Enhancing Clinical Workflows and Reducing Physician Burnout Through AI Agents Providing Automated Documentation, Patient History Summarization, and Visit Summaries

According to a report from the American Medical Association (AMA), almost half of the physicians in the US have at least one symptom of burnout. This condition is mostly linked to the large amount and difficulty of administrative work they must do. Tasks like documentation, managing electronic health records (EHRs), coding, billing, and scheduling appointments add a lot to their workload.

Data shows that doctors spend about 15 minutes with each patient but need an extra 15 to 20 minutes to update the EHRs with relevant visit information. This means half of a doctor’s clinical time is spent on paperwork, not direct patient care. Over time, this can cause job unhappiness, mental tiredness, and more doctors leaving their jobs.

Money pressures make these problems worse. Many healthcare groups in the US work with low profit margins, around 4.5%, according to a report from November 2024. Accurate billing and coding are needed to get paid properly and keep the organization running. This adds pressure to be fast and exact with paperwork.

Role of AI Agents in Automated Healthcare Documentation

AI agents in healthcare are digital helpers that use recent technologies like large language models (LLMs) and retrieval-augmented generation (RAG). They automate routine but time-consuming tasks. These virtual helpers can listen to patient-doctor talks, summarize important points, write clinical notes, and even suggest next steps. They work with existing EHR systems.

For example, Oracle Health’s Clinical AI Agent cuts documentation time by 41%. This saves about 66 minutes per provider each day. It makes draft clinical notes in many languages quickly, pulls out patient data and coding information, and links this directly to the patient’s medical record. Clinical leaders say it helps bring administrative and clinical teams closer and keeps patients more involved.

Microsoft Dragon Copilot also makes documentation easier through voice dictation and listening during clinical visits. It records conversations with many people and in several languages, turning them into notes for specific medical fields. This tool saves clinicians about five minutes per patient. This allows them to open 13 more appointment times each month. More than 70% of clinicians using this technology say it lowers burnout and improves their work-life balance. Ninety-three percent of patients say their overall experience is better because doctors pay more attention.

These AI tools help with specialty-specific notes and are trained on millions of clinical cases. They are more accurate and reliable than traditional transcription or manual note-taking. Because they make clinical records quickly and accurately, doctors can spend less time on computers and more time with patients.

Patient History Summarization and Visit Summaries: Improving Decision-Making

Healthcare AI agents do more than just write notes. They gather complex patient data and give doctors short summaries of important medical history, lab results, imaging, and treatment plans before and during visits. This gives a clearer clinical view and helps doctors make better decisions faster.

St. John’s Health community hospital shows how AI agents “listen” to patient visits and make summarized, easy-to-read notes after the visit. The ambient clinical intelligence technology records talks in real time and creates digital records that doctors can check quickly. This automation saves a lot of manual work needed to write detailed notes and lowers errors and missing information.

Also, AI agents add current medical research, diagnostic imaging reports, and clinical guidelines to help doctors make personal treatment plans. The AI links smoothly with EHRs and gives predictive analytics and decision support that improve diagnosis and patient outcomes over time.

AI and Workflow Automation in Healthcare Practice Management

Healthcare groups benefit greatly from automating workflows that support patients, clinical notes, and operations. AI agents use natural language processing (NLP), machine learning, and ambient listening technologies to streamline parts of clinical workflows:

  • Appointment Scheduling and Patient Intake: AI agents manage appointment bookings by phone or chat. This cuts wait times and human mistakes. They can also preregister patients, check insurance, and collect required information before visits, helping front-office work.
  • Clinical Documentation: AI listens to doctor-patient talks and creates accurate, specialty-specific notes during or right after visits. This lowers the work of transcription and helps with coding rules by pulling out needed clinical data automatically.
  • Diagnostic and Treatment Support: AI agents summarize patient histories, study lab results, and add current clinical research to give support for decisions. These tools increase diagnostic accuracy and help plan personalized care.
  • Billing and Coding Automation: Automatic coding follows payer rules. This reduces claim denials and speeds up getting paid. AI coding helpers keep documentation consistent and follow payer rules.
  • Follow-Up and Patient Engagement: AI sends appointment reminders, medication refill prompts, and patient education materials using natural language. This boosts adherence and patient satisfaction.

This workflow automation better uses resources, improves patient flow, lowers mental load on clinicians, and reduces burnout.

Addressing Physician Burnout with AI Documentation Assistants

Physician burnout has many causes, but too much documentation and clerical work are major ones. The American Medical Association says nearly half of doctors feel symptoms related to too much administrative work.

AI-powered documentation assistants help by cutting documentation time by 30-50%, according to recent studies. These tools automate notes like SOAP, History of Present Illness (HPI), and visit summaries accurately and in real time. Doctors get more time to work with patients, think through care, and lower mental tiredness.

This real-time note-taking is different from simple transcription. It understands context, organizes patient data usefully, and lets doctors adjust the style. Doctors keep control by reviewing AI drafts carefully for accuracy, applying their clinical judgment.

Hospitals using AI note tools say documentation quality improves with more complete and consistent records. These AI helpers link well with popular EHRs like Epic and Cerner, speeding up and improving data entry, which supports clinician productivity.

Real-World Experiences and Organizational Feedback

Several healthcare groups in the US have started using AI documentation with good results:

  • AtlantiCare: Providers report a 41% cut in total documentation time. This saves about 66 minutes daily per clinician. The extra time helps improve patient care and doctor satisfaction.
  • Beacon Health System: Clinicians say they spend more time talking with patients instead of managing records, which improves care quality.
  • WellSpan Health: Leaders say AI agents provide consistent, reliable help across workflows. This boosts efficiency and patient experience.
  • Billings Clinic: The group values AI note tools for their reliability across languages. This supports documentation for diverse patients.
  • Northwestern Medicine: This group made a 112% return on investment and improved service quality using Microsoft’s AI tools.

These cases show AI agents are more than tools. They are helpers that reduce workload, improve documentation accuracy, and make patient interactions better.

Challenges and Considerations in AI Adoption

Even with benefits, using AI in healthcare notes has challenges. Rules about privacy under HIPAA, data security, and trust from clinicians remain important. AI must be very accurate to avoid mistakes that harm patient safety or note quality.

Integrating AI with different EHR systems and workflows is hard. Flexible and interoperable solutions are needed. These often run on secure cloud platforms to handle high computing needs. People need to check AI notes carefully and keep control over clinical decisions.

Also, using AI means ongoing training for staff, adjusting tools for specific specialties, and adding feedback to keep making AI better and more useful.
